    I am no expert on the Philippines, but have visited a few times. I think meeting guys on the Internet is a good way of experiencing the gay life. Angeles City, if I remember correctly, is about two hour bus ride from Manila. The American Clark Air Force base was located here before the Americans were kicked out. This is where Air Asia flies in and out of now. I found no gay life here, but instead a bunch of girlie bars.

    Manila was interesting. I found no go-go boy bars, but a lot of cruising in the shopping centers. Harrison Plaza is an older shopping center that was cruisy (I was told to watch out because of the rough trade). There is a newer one up the road and I think it was called Robinson's, but am not sure. Also some cruising in Rizal park at night, but I am sure you need to be careful.

    Malate is the area I found to be the best area for gay life. Several gay bars and it seemed to me to be a trendy and popular area. If you can meet someone on the Internet, I am sure they will show you the town.

    As fairly regular visitor I have found some of the Gay scene, but with the help of teh locals... it does not advertise itself widely. Manila has a number of Macho Dancer Bars spread around town, particularly in Malate and Quezon. Of those I have visited so far Big Papa's is the best. White Bird used to be good but had gone down hill last time I was there. The area near Remedios Circle in Malate has a number of gay bars and clubs. Anyone want direction I can provide them

    Angeles is far from Manila and definitely in the sticks!!!
    If you are flying there on AirAsia, you can get a Philtranco bus directly into Manila.
    But better to fly into Aquino Airport. Stay in Malate!!!

    If you want to enjoy the finest beach, fly to Boracay. It is a short 60-minute flight and a fun trip on the pump boat to the island.
    There are many nice Pinoy Guys there, or you can take one with you... Firday's Hotel is the best, but expensive.

    Another nice trip is to the island of Mindoro Oriental. You take the bus from Manila down to the port of Bantangas and the pump boat across to the island. You have your choice of beaches. Puerto Galera, Sabang, Coco Beach or White Beach. I suggest the Portofino Hotel or the Red Sun in Small La Laguna. Night life outside of Puerto Galery is SLOW. So take a friend, kick back, and enjoy the seafood.
